It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Kenneth "Ken" Taylor Carroll of Riverview, NB, who passed away at the Albert House Hospice SENB on September 18, 2025. He was the beloved husband of Annette LeBlanc-Carroll of Riverview, NB. Ken was born in Moncton, NB, to the late Kenneth and Florence (nee Taylor) Carroll.

Ken was born in Sunnybrae and attended Moncton High School. As a teenager, he could be found dancing up a storm at the YMCA Saturday Night dance. Ken would keep on dancing, taking ballroom dancing lessons with his wife, Annette. His favourite dance was the jive and when the music started, Ken could be seen dancing around the room with everyone trying to keep up. 

Ken taught at Riverview High School for 30 years and was a president of the New Brunswick Teachers’ Association for School District 02. He was a past president of the Retired Teachers of the Greater Moncton Area. His love of meeting new people lead Ken to his new career as a real estate agent. He was a past director of the Greater Moncton Real Estate Board.

Ken was an avid duplicate bridge player. He enjoyed hosting bridge games at his cottage at Cap Bimet.  He participated in many tournaments in the Maritimes and in Florida. 

Ken loved to travel. He spent time with his wife in Florida and enjoyed a good cruise, especially the food. Ken loved food. Every Wednesday evening, Ken and Annette would meet up with their dinner club friends to frequent a different restaurant in the area.

Ken loved to shop. He was always in search of a good deal whether it be clothes, furniture, decor, or travel. In his later years, Ken had great fun ordering from Temu. 

Ken will be dearly missed by his loving wife Annette, daughters Jennifer Cunningham (Shaun), Elizabeth Carroll-Maillet, and Kathleen Carroll, his grandchildren Taylor (Andrew), Dylan, Meaghan (Madeleine), Ainsley, and Carson, and great grandchildren Violet and Sullivan.
